Beijing, the Chinese Capital, was named amongst the most polluted cities in the world by 2021. The pollution in the city was so elaborate that even the surrounding buildings, hills and lush green trees were not visible from Tiananmen Square due to the mist. There was also a danger of the Winter Olympics being in trouble, but now it is not so. Beijing's air is so clean these days that athletes participating in the Olympics can see the mountains and green valleys around the city from afar.
According to a recent report by the Chicago-based Energy Policy Institute, China has initiated several projects to improve air quality. Government schemes were strictly implemented. Strict rules were made for coal-fired factories. The number of cars on the roads was reduced to prevent air pollution. In homes, coal-fired boilers were replaced with gas or electric heaters.
The effect of these measures taken by the Chinese government is also visible. Pollution was 6 times more than the limit in China last year, but now everything is under control. China is committed to being carbon neutral by 2060. However, China is still heavily dependent on coal for electricity.
Despite this, significant progress has been made in reducing the damage caused by coal. Developing clean energy from sources such as wind and solar.
